Finance Review Summary — Support Outsourcing Plan

For sales leads: the review of outsourcing Tier 1 support to Harrowgate Services projects a 22% reduction in per-ticket cost by Q2, offset by a one-time transition charge. Ansel Drury's team flagged churn risk among Pinnacle-tier accounts, so handoff scripts will be piloted first. Please factor revised SLA language into renewals. Strategic context for this decision follows below.

management briefing: Jorixax Holdings is in early talks to buy Casixax Holdings for about $420.3 million. The Fenmir launch date is October 27, and nothing goes to the press before then. Legal wants the Keloxek Foods term sheet redrafted before April 16.

Audit item 14: Verify GC pause times in the Quickmatch pairing service stay under 50ms at p99. New team members should check the weekly pause histogram in the Lattica dashboard and flag any regression above threshold. Escalations for sustained pauses go to the runtime performance owner, named below.

signatory, tadup-fahog: Zorwyn Keleth

Onboarding note for eng sync: the Wrenfold firmware fleet updates through three channels — `canary`, `ring1`, and `stable`. Devices poll the Larchgate update broker hourly; channel assignment lives in the device manifest, never in firmware. When testing locally, run the broker emulator and point your device shim at it with `UPDATE_CHANNEL=canary`. The emulator signs update manifests exactly like production, so it needs real signing material. Add the signing secret to your emulator env file on the following line.

sealed setting: ARCHIVE_KEY3=8d0

## Runbook: PickPath Optimizer

PickPath crunches warehouse pick-lists every fifteen minutes for the Dunmore fulfillment site. If routes look stale, restart the optimizer pod — state rebuilds from the queue, so it's safe. Heads up for reviewers: config lives in one env file, nothing in code. The optimizer authenticates to the routing service with a credential set on the next line.

vault entry, yahaf-tagug: LEDGER_TOKEN20=884d77d1a8b98aa4edfb